Job description

As a Visual Merchandiser & Trainer with Swatch Group, U.S., the position will be responsible to support the watch sales within our retail and wholesale account through visual merchandising and training. This role will oversee the visual representation of our brand and products in all boutiques (retail and wholesale) within assigned region.

ProfileResponsible for ensuring that store merchandise presentations meet Company standards and are in accordance with Company guidelines.Preparation of all communication materials as per visual displays in accordance to brand's guidelines.Training of Store Managers and associates on current visual and brand standards.Contribute to achieving sales volume goals by ensuring effective presentations and maintenance of all product categories, making sure that all stores are set up correctly during promotions and regular business.Manage directly with vendor and place and follow up on all visual orders to ensure that all visual needs are implemented on time.Coordinate with visibility internal on centralized mailing of visual materials to trade and ensure the stores place them.Partner with management in planning and executing functional training, leadership development, product and sales training and other needed training strategies.Provide comprehensive communication and training programs to storesLook for any visual opportunities within or outside the stores and come up with great window decoration ideas.Identify possible business opportunities, keeping abreast of regional business trends by reading and understanding business reportsCreate and maintain photo library of boutique conditions prior to and after a visitProvide a recap report of the store visitsRealize first-in-class set up and decoration of the Brands sponsored events, mono- and multi-brand related events, in order to maximize the Brand 's visual impact according to brand guidelines.All duties assigned by ManagementProfessional requirements
